I'm planning to buy a used GPU this year, and I've noticed that both the 3060 and 3070 are priced similarly in the used market, around 20,000rs (or about $212). My main goal is to play some demanding games at 1080p on Ultra settings. Also, I do some work where VRAM matters, but I believe 8GB should be sufficient for my needs. Which GPU would be a better choice?
5 Answers
Honestly, for 1080p gaming, 8GB should be more than enough for the foreseeable future. If you're prioritizing performance over VRAM, go with the 3070!
The 3070 is just a stronger GPU all around. While some may worry about the 8GB VRAM, it's plenty for 1080p gaming, especially right now.
If you're mostly gaming, I'd definitely recommend going for the 3070. It's almost 50% more powerful than the 3060, so you'll notice a solid performance boost in your games.
I've been using a 3070 at 1440p, and it performs beautifully. For 1080p gaming, it's going to give you an amazing experience even in the heaviest AAA titles.
Don't get too caught up on the 12GB of the 3060. Based on my experience, that extra memory isn't really useful since the 3060's overall power is pretty limited. I’ve got one, and it's only decent for older games without mods.
